B.B.King the King of Blues

King performed and record sine 1940s. He turned to playing blues and moved to Memphis, Tennesse to start a music career, in the late 1940s. Guitarists like Keith Richards and Eric Clapton sang his praises, and King began performing in rock and jazz clubs and had crossover hits like " Paying The Cost To Be The Boss" (1968) and "The Thrill Is Gone" (1970). King has recorded over more than 50 albums, won 13 Grammys and received dorzen of awards and honors over the years, and he still performs four or five nights a week.
